Why Wipro's Q1 Net Profit Was Flat

Why Wipro's Q1 Net Profit Was Flat

Rediff.com18 Jul 2026

Wipro's net profit in the first quarter saw minimal growth, rising less than one per cent to 3,352 crore, while revenue increased by 10.6 per cent to 24,480 crore. The IT services segment, a key metric, grew by only one per cent year-on-year, falling short of analyst estimates amidst a challenging demand environment and longer decision cycles from clients.

Bajaj Auto to expand annual capacity to over 9 million vehicles after record Q1 performance

Bajaj Auto to expand annual capacity to over 9 million vehicles after record Q1 performance

Rediff.com22 Jul 2026

Bajaj Auto plans to increase its annual production capacity by nearly 25 per cent, from around 7 million to over 9 million vehicles, in the coming quarters. This expansion is driven by strong export demand and rapid growth in electric vehicles, which have stretched current capacity across key product segments.

FIFA World Cup 2026: Mexico's 'Losers Cafe' serves comfort with every sip

FIFA World Cup 2026: Mexico's 'Losers Cafe' serves comfort with every sip

Rediff.com2 Jul 2026

Amid the sea of green that washed over Mexico City after the country's World Cup victory over Ecuador on Tuesday, one shop defiantly hoisted the Ecuadorian flag and welcomed all the downtrodden fans of Mexico's opponents to a place of refuge. Welcome to the Losers Cafe, a coffee shop in the cosmopolitan neighbourhood of Condesa that is comforting fans of the losing teams.
